One Big, Beautiful Win for Americans

On Thursday, the House passed the One Big Beautiful Bill Act, which delivers for working class Americans and small businesses. I spoke on the House floor in favor of the One Big, Beautiful Bill, which would extend the Trump tax cuts to prevent historic tax increases on small businesses and working-class families. The average taxpayer in Michigan's 5th District would face a 27% tax hike, if these vital provisions were to expire at the end of the year. The One Big, Beautiful Bill also delivers up to a $11,700 increase in yearly take-home pay for a typical family of four in Michigan.

  • Extending and expanding the Child Tax Credit
  • Bolstering our military capabilities and national security
  • Building more efficient and effective government programs
  • Empowering small businesses
  • Revitalizing our manufacturing base
  • Supporting domestic energy production

As Chairman of the Education and Workforce Committee, my portion of the bill would save taxpayers over $250 billion by fixing our student loan repayment system and ending uncapped lending.  

This historic legislation, which was signed into law by President Trump on Independence Day, will help usher in a new golden age of prosperity in America.


Students, families, and small businesses rely on internet connectivity each day, and we can’t allow rural areas to get left behind. I have introduced the Brownfields Broadband Deployment Act to help accelerate broadband deployment and close the digital divide. This legislation would remove unnecessary barriers to building broadband projects on a brownfield site so that we can promote new wireless transmission infrastructure including towers, antennas, or other support structures and buildings.

The 2025 Congressional App Challenge is now underway! I would like to extend an invitation to all middle and high school students in Michigan's 5th District to create and submit an original app for a chance to win. It’s a wonderful opportunity for students to explore and enhance their computer science skills. 

All apps must be submitted by October 30th. For more information, please visit walberg.house.gov or https://www.congressionalappchallenge.us/. I look forward to seeing the creativity and ingenuity displayed by Michigan's 5th District!
